The creation and development history of industrial furnace The creation and 
development of industrial furnace plays a very important role in human 
progress. In the Shang Dynasty, a copper smelting furnace with a temperature of 
1200 ℃ and an inner diameter of 0.8 m appeared. In the spring and Autumn period 
and the Warring States period, people further mastered the technology of 
raising the furnace temperature on the basis of copper melting furnace, and 
thus produced cast iron. In 1794, the straight barrel Cupola for melting cast 
iron appeared in the world. Later, in 1864, French Martin built the first 
steel-making open hearth furnace heated by gas fuel based on the principle of 
Siemens regenerative furnace. He used the regenerator to preheat the air and 
gas at high temperature, so as to ensure the temperature above 1600 ℃ required 
for steelmaking. Around 1900, the power supply was gradually sufficient, and 
various resistance furnaces, electric arc furnaces and cored induction furnaces 
were used.

Vacuum Brazing Process Of YT05 Hard Alloy And 40Cr Steel Temperature plays an 
important role in the hot working of metal. No matter what metal, in high 
temperature will become soft, and most of the metal in high temperature can be 
bent, silver, pressure, extrusion, rolling, high temperature will make the 
metal melt. High temperature can also eliminate the internal stress of metal. 
In order to remove the internal stress, the metal is heated and then cooled 
without new internal stress. This short-range process is called annealing.

vacuum furnace In 1950s, coreless induction furnace developed rapidly. Later 
came the electron beam furnace, which used electron beam to impact solid fuel, 
which could strengthen surface heating and melt high melting point materials. 
The earliest furnace used for forging heating is hand forging furnace. Its 
working space is a concave groove filled with coal. The air for combustion is 
supplied from the lower part of the groove, and the workpiece is buried in the 
coal for heating. This kind of furnace has very low thermal efficiency and poor 
heating quality, and can only heat small workpieces. Later, it was developed 
into a semi closed or fully closed chamber furnace made of firebrick. It can 
use coal, gas or oil as fuel, and electricity as heat source. Workpieces are 
heated in the furnace.
